I bought my first bike last weekend in the beautiful shape of a 2002 NSR... Mmmmmmmmm
Anyway... the other night (freezing night by the way), I was sat on the bike, lights on, engine off, waiting for a friend... I went to start the bike and it wouldnt start. The headlights cut off but the Neutral and Side Stand light was on... when I went to switch the lights on, the 2 lights cut off and the headlights never came on... I ended up bump starting the bike... which worked.
Last night, I tried starting the bike to no avail. I can hear a buzzing noise from the battery and a whirring noise from just under the petrol tank...
I've noticed when warming the bike and when Im riding that the dial lights dim slightly, then when I rev the lights get brighter...?

look the chapter about checking battery . if your battery is OK you may have a charging problem or a reg/rec problem , look the chapter about mesuring alternator ____________________ the worst day fishing is better than the best day working |

After an ongoing battle with the bike since the topic started, it's finally OK!
**** WOOOOHOOOOOOOOOO!!!
I got her back an hour ago and I am absolutely over the flippin' moon!!!!
Here goes:
Carried out service/checkover
Investigate electric start - carried out test on battery - Requires new battery
Resecured mudguard mount bolts
Refitted rear pad anti-rattle clip correctly
Replaced plug cap
Removed both wheels, removed tyres, replaced both valves and rebuilt
Changed brake fluid front/rear
Drained coolant, replenished anti-freeze
All in all including parts, sundries and whatever - £160
I was initially told that the valves on the tyres were going but shoud be fine, to keep an eye on it... I thought "I might as well replace it now considering I got the money"... good job too as the mechanic said they were on their way out and it was only a matter of time before I would have had a problem.
Good news was I took the battery back to the place I got it from in not long ago and they tested it and replaced it free of charge... took it back to Bike Medic who tested the reg/rec - no problem with that... started first time! I was told by both the mechanic and Speedwells themselves who I bought the battery from that it was a duff battery and was discharging itself.
